Welcome to our very first Friday Coaching Corner! In this session, I answer questions from a listener navigating the challenges of living near her abusive ex, parenting through manipulation, and dealing with silent treatment in co-parenting apps.The listener shares that her ex still lives in an outbuilding on the marital property, creating constant stress and safety concerns. On top of that, her ex is weaponizing the children against her, and she’s experiencing co-parenting sabotage through both denial of parenting time and the silent treatment in their communication app.I answer these questions...How can I create a sense of safety in my home when my abusive ex lives so close by?How do I respond when my 13-year-old mimics my ex’s critical tone and behavior toward me, and how should I explain this shift to their therapist?What strategies can I use when my co-parent stops responding to messages and uses the silent treatment as a tactic?Want to have your questions featured on a Friday Coaching Corner?
